Valiance ranked #20 from Serbia are clashing against team Denial ranked #50 from South Africa in the WESG 2018 World Finals that has 27 teams competing for the prize pool of $890,000. The tournament is played on LAN (offline) in Chongqing, China, and this will be the best of 2 match.

Valiance map highlights in the previous three months: Overpass is at 100,0% win rate on only one played map - WIN/DRAW/LOSS - 1/0/0, Cache 90,9% on 11 played maps 10/0/1, Nuke 83,3% on 12 played maps 10/0/2, Mirage 80,0% on 30 played maps 24/0/6, Dust2 68,2% on 22 played maps 15/0/7, Train 61,1% on 18 played maps 11/0/7, and Inferno with 40,0% win rate on ten played maps 4/0/6.

Denial map performance in the last three months: Inferno is at 71,4% win rate on seven played maps - WON/TIED/LOST - 5/0/2, Train 60,0% on five played maps 3/0/2, Overpass 60,0% on five played maps 3/0/2, Nuke 42,9% on seven played maps 3/0/4, Dust2 0,0% on only one played map 0/0/1, and Mirage with 0,0% win rate on two played maps 0/0/2.

Pistol performance in the previous 100 days both on online and offline (LAN) events goes to team Valiance who have just slight advantage over team Denial (ex-Bravado) with 45,8% win rating over Bravado who have 45,5% total.

Valiance played 13 maps and won 11, converted, they played nine games and won eight. In February they played 37 maps and won 28, in other words, they played 22 matches and won 15. In January they played 37 maps and won 24. In December they played 17 maps and won 12, converted, they played eight games and won six.

Denial played 13 maps in March and won seven, converted, they played eight games and won four. In February they played 13 maps and won seven, in other words, they played the same amount of matches because they were all best of 1. In January they played only one map which they lost against TeamOne on Inferno 12-16.
